Why do paper mills need to use paper-making bactericides

发布日期:2026-07-21 阅读数量:

Papermaking bactericides are a new generation of chemical agents used for sterilization and mold prevention in papermaking. They possess excellent characteristics such as high efficiency, broad spectrum, and low toxicity, capable of killing and eliminating harmful bacteria in pulp within a short period of time. There are many types of papermaking bactericides, which can be divided into inorganic bactericides and organic bactericides based on their molecular structures.  Efficient broad-spectrum bactericides are typically non-oxidizing bactericides, whose bactericidal mechanism involves increasing the permeability of cell membranes, cutting off the supply of nutrients to cell tubes, disrupting intracellular metabolism, or altering the protein structure of cells to prevent intracellular energy production and limit enzyme synthesis. Therefore, such bactericides are very effective against planktonic microorganisms and biofilms. They not only restrict and eliminate existing biofilms but also penetrate into the interior of biofilms to react with anaerobic microorganisms trapped within. For a certain non-oxidizing bactericide used in papermaking, its effectiveness is limited to certain microorganisms, which is different from oxidizing bactericides.
